Dorothy E. Roark, 88, of Conestoga View, formerly of 33 E. Farnum St., died Wednesday night of cancer.
She was a homemaker.
Born in White Rock, she was a daughter of the late William J. and Louise Shade McCardell.
She was married to the late Raymond W. Roark.
Surviving are a son, R. Donald, married to Lily Roark of Murrietta, Calif.; two daughters, Janet M., married to Ronald A. Kuhn, and Jeanne McComsey, both of Lancaster; 12 grandchildren; and seven great-grandchildren.
Two sons, Thomas G. and Terry R., and a brother William Paul McCardell preceded her in death.
Published on December 29, 2000, Intelligencer Journal (Lancaster, PA)
